AXForum  
Вернуться   AXForum > Microsoft Dynamics AX > DAX: Программирование
All
Забыли пароль?
Зарегистрироваться Правила Справка Пользователи Сообщения за день Поиск

 
 
Опции темы Поиск в этой теме Опции просмотра
Старый 22.04.2005, 14:11   #1  
gec is offline
gec
Участник
 
4 / 10 (1) +
Регистрация: 22.04.2005
Адрес: Киев
получение свойства объекта AOT
Нужно получить значние свойства "CacheLookup" таблицы из X++ кода.
Спасибо.
Старый 22.04.2005, 15:04   #2  
Deep Dreamer is offline
Deep Dreamer
Участник
 
76 / 24 (1) +++
Регистрация: 05.03.2004
Адрес: Москва
PHP код:
RecordCacheLevel level;
dictTable dt = new dictTable(tablenum(LedgerTable));
;
level dt.cacheLookup();
info(strfmt("%1"level)); 
Вместо LedgerTable напиши ту таблицу, что надо.
Старый 11.05.2005, 14:40   #3  
malex is offline
malex
Участник
 
164 / 19 (1) ++
Регистрация: 10.08.2004
Адрес: Тверь, Москва
?
Вопрос в продолжении темы: а можно ли не открывая форму, получить список имен всех ее DS?
Старый 11.05.2005, 15:25   #4  
Deep Dreamer is offline
Deep Dreamer
Участник
 
76 / 24 (1) +++
Регистрация: 05.03.2004
Адрес: Москва
Ну в принципе такой вариант, наверное, Вас устроит...

PHP код:
    formBuildDataSource fbds;
    
formRun fr;
    
int     i;
    
Args    a = new Args("FactureJournal_RU");

    
fr = new formRun(a);

    for(
i=0;i<fr.form().dataSourceCount();i++)
    {
        
fbds fr.form().dataSource(i+1);
        
info(strfmt("DataSource name: %1, Table name: %2" fbds.name(), tableid2name(fbds.table())  ) );
    } 
В коде нет fr.init() и fr.run(). Форма не запустится.
Старый 11.05.2005, 16:09   #5  
malex is offline
malex
Участник
 
164 / 19 (1) ++
Регистрация: 10.08.2004
Адрес: Тверь, Москва
Thanks
Я делал нечто похожее:

PHP код:
        args    = new Args(this.FormName);
        
formRun classFactory.formRunClass(args);
        
formRun.init();

        for (
1<= formRun.dataSourceCount(); i++)
            
Info(formRun.dataSource(i).name()); 
 

Похожие темы
Тема Автор Раздел Ответов Посл. сообщение
axStart: Please keep the AOT reports in Dynamics AX next release alive Blog bot DAX Blogs 2 13.12.2008 12:18
Добавить свойство объекта в AOT SergeK DAX: Программирование 5 05.09.2008 12:33
daxmy: AOT Find function Blog bot DAX Blogs 0 17.08.2007 01:23
Проблема с получение коллекции (массива) из COM-объекта. VES DAX: Программирование 6 24.03.2006 18:59
Вопрос про свойства объекта АОТ Paul_ST DAX: Программирование 6 27.09.2005 15:54

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.
Быстрый переход

Рейтинг@Mail.ru
Часовой пояс GMT +3, время: 06:15.